Overview of the Incident
A serious food poisoning incident occurred recently in Caserta, Italy, affecting approximately sixty individuals, including a 20-month-old child. This alarming situation unfolded during a birthday party held at a local restaurant, raising significant health concerns for the community.
Details of the Event
The birthday celebration, which was meant to be a joyous occasion, turned tragic as many attendees began experiencing severe symptoms shortly after the event. Reports indicate that around twenty individuals sought medical attention at various hospitals, including those in Caserta and nearby Marcianise.
Symptoms Reported
Those affected reported symptoms consistent with food poisoning, such as n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and stomach cramps. Health officials have advised anyone experiencing similar symptoms to seek medical attention promptly.
Response from Health Authorities
In response to the outbreak, local health authorities have initiated an investigation into the source of the food contamination. They are working closely with the restaurant involved to ensure cleanliness and safety measures are adhered to, preventing future occurrences of such incidents. The health department is also closely monitoring the situation and has been proactive in disseminating information regarding food safety to the public.
